Co-op games thrive on the interactions between players, making team dynamics critical to the overall engagement and satisfaction of the experience. When players collaborate towards a common goal, they develop a sense of camaraderie that enhances the enjoyment of the game. This can range from strategic planning in games that require precise coordination to supporting each other in moments of crisis. For instance, when a player steps into a healer role, their ability to save teammates not only reinforces their importance within the team but also fosters a sense of accomplishment and connectedness among all players.
Moreover, the diverse skill sets each player brings to the table can significantly influence the gameplay experience. This diversity allows teams to tackle challenges in various ways, encouraging creativity in problem-solving and making each session unique. As players learn to communicate and adapt to each other’s strengths and weaknesses, they build a robust team dynamic that keeps everyone engaged and invested. Ultimately, the rich interplay of collaboration, competition, and personal growth in co-op games keeps players coming back for more, seeking to improve their strategies and strengthen their bonds with teammates.
